Hope For The Day

Hope For The Day reported paying Benjamin Kohn, Executive Dir., $105,000 in total compensation (FY 2024).

That places Benjamin Kohn at approximately the 69th percentile among 756 similarly sized mental health & crisis intervention nonprofits (median $86,737).
